Cleaning in the dental lab and dental office—efficient hygiene processes for restorations, splints, dentures, and instruments

Cleaning is a crucial component of smooth and hygienically safe workflows in dental laboratories, dental offices and orthodontic practices. This is especially true in settings where restorations, splints, dentures or small instruments are handled on a daily basis; such environments require cleaning methods that are thorough, gentle on materials and cost-effective at the same time. The dentist often plays a central role in this process: reliable removal of temporary cement from restorations, professional cleaning of splints and dentures, and efficient cleaning of instruments and accessories in an ultrasonic unit save the team valuable time while also creating tangible added value for the patient. In particular, professional cleaning of removable restorations as an additional service can enhance patient loyalty, since it combines comfort, hygiene, and value retention.

Real-world benefits: thorough and gentle cleaning, noticeable time savings in the dental office and laboratory, better integration into hygienic reprocessing workflows, and additional patient service provided by professional cleaning of restorations, dentures, and splints.

Typical applications in the laboratory and dental office

  • Cleaning of restorations: reliable removal of temporary cement and other residues to efficiently prepare for placement, inspection, or further processing.
  • Cleaning of splints and dentures: thorough removal of plaque, stains, and deposits as a valuable service in the dental office and laboratory—with direct benefits for hygiene, wearing comfort, and patient satisfaction.
  • Ultrasonic cleaning of instruments and various tools: particularly suitable for delicate structures, hard-to-reach areas, and small instruments that would otherwise require time-consuming manual cleaning.
  • Systematic process support in the dental office: Cleaning devices that integrate seamlessly into existing clinical procedures for medical devices and hygiene protocols create greater safety, clarity, and efficiency in daily operations.

In professional settings such as dental offices and laboratories, cleaning is not just about cleaning performance — it’s primarily about contributing to a clearly structured workflow. Dental offices, in particular, require cleaning devices suitable for medical devices, which also comply with the MDR and can be integrated into the medical device workflow. This ensures safe use, facilitates integration into existing hygiene protocols, and supports traceable processes in daily practice. For the dentist, this results in a genuine gain in efficiency: restorations can be reprocessed more quickly before placement or inspection; the professional cleaning of dentures and splints can be offered as a service; and the team’s workload is noticeably reduced when it comes to manual tasks. At the same time, this service enhances patient loyalty because the dental office offers an additional, directly tangible benefit beyond the treatment itself. The interaction between the device and cleaning agents is also crucial: Workflows can only be truly optimized when the cleaning device, cleaning chemicals, and accessories are perfectly matched. The right cleaning agents support the gentle removal of temporary cement, plaque, or stains, enhance the cleaning efficiency of ultrasonic cleaning, and ensure reproducible results. In this way, individual components come together to form a coordinated system that improves hygiene, saves time, and enhances process quality in dental laboratories, dental offices, and orthodontic practices alike.
